Figma vs. Adobe XD: A General Comparison
Figma and Adobe XD offer different advantages for designers. Below, we compare the strengths of both tools in a table.
Advantages of Figma
| Feature | Figma |
|---|---|
| Collaboration | Real-time multi-user support |
| Platform Independence | Access via browser |
| Plugin Support | Customizable design options with numerous plugins |
| Prototyping | Fast and easy prototyping options |
Strengths of Adobe XD
| Feature | Adobe XD |
|---|---|
| Integration | Full integration with the Adobe ecosystem |
| Prototyping and Animation | Advanced animation and transition features |
| User Testing | Easy sharing of prototypes |
| Performance | Faster loading times and smooth working experience |
User Experience and Team Communication
Figma enables teams to communicate effectively even while working remotely, thanks to its user-friendly interface and collaboration features. Adobe XD, on the other hand, accelerates team workflows by offering more integration and features in the prototyping process.

The Overlooked Point for Most Teams: Integration of Design Tools
Integration Capabilities of Figma and Adobe XD
Both tools facilitate users' workflows by providing integration with popular software and services. Figma can integrate with tools like Slack and JIRA, while Adobe XD works seamlessly with Photoshop and Illustrator.
